Fully updated, CANFOR is the recommended tool for assessing the needs of people with mental health problems in forensic settings.

Über den Autor
Stuart Thomas is Professor of Forensic Mental Health at RMIT University, Melbourne, Australia. His main research interests focus on law enforcement and public health, outcome measurement in forensic mental health, stigma and lived experience perspectives.
